//
//Many thanks to BlobFisk
//http://www.webmasterworld.com/forum91/442.htm
//
//Without his detailed description this
//would not have been possible
//

function reDo() { 
 window.location.reload(); 
 } 

window.onresize = reDo;

//Define global variables
var timerID = null;
var timerOn = false;
var timecount = 40;
// Change this to the time delay that you desire
var what = null;
var newbrowser = true;
var check = false; 

function initHelp() { 
//alert("inithelp");
 if (document.layers) { 
 layerRef="document.layers"; 
 styleSwitch=""; 
 visibleVar="show"; 
 what ="ns4"; 
 } 
 else if(document.all) { 
 layerRef="document.all"; 
 styleSwitch=".style"; 
 visibleVar="visible"; 
 what ="ie4"; 
 } 
 else if(document.getElementById) { 
 layerRef="document.getElementByID"; 
 styleSwitch=".style"; 
 visibleVar="visible"; 
 what="dom1"; 
 } 
 else { 
 what="none"; 
 newbrowser = false; 
 } 
check = true; 
} 

// Toggles the layer visibility on 
function show(layerName) { 
 if(check) { 
hideAll();
 if (what =="none") { 
 return; 
 } 
 else if (what == "dom1") { 
 document.getElementById(layerName).style.visibility="visible"; 
var bbla = document.getElementById("layerName");
bbla.style.left = "50%"
bbla.style.top = "50%"
var bblaleft = bbla.offsetLeft
bbla.style.left = bblaleft - bbla.offsetWidth/2
var bblatop = bbla.offsetTop
bbla.style.top = bblatop - bbla.offsetHeight/2
 } 
 else { 
 eval(layerRef+'["'+layerName+'"]'+styleSwitch+'.visibility="visible"'); 
 } 
 } 
 else { 
 return; 
 } 
 } 

// Toggles the layer visibility off 
function hide(layerName) { 
 if(check) { 
 if (what =="none") { 
 return; 
 } 
 else if (what == "dom1") { 
 document.getElementById(layerName).style.visibility="hidden"; 
 } 
 else { 
 eval(layerRef+'["'+layerName+'"]'+styleSwitch+'.visibility="hidden"'); 
 } 
 } 
 else { 
 return; 
 } 
 } 

function hideAll() { 
//alert("hideall");
hide('Privacy'); 
// hide('Bonus'); 
 } 

function startTime() { 
 if (timerOn == false) { 
 timerID=setTimeout( "hideAll()" , timecount); 
 timerOn = true; 
 } 
 } 

function stopTime() { 
 if (timerOn) { 
 clearTimeout(timerID); 
 timerID = null; 
 timerOn = false; 
 } 
 }

function onLoad() { 
 initHelp(); 
 } 

//function initLoader() {
//alert("inside initloader");
//	MainMenuLoader();
//	hideAll();
//}

function WindowLoader() {
//alert("inside windowloader");
//		MainMenuLoader();
		initHelp();
		hideAll();
}
